Generally, softened water contains about 12.5 mg of sodium per 8 oz glass, although the exact amount varies depending on how hard your water is. Studies have generally found hard water to have positive effects on the health of its drinkers. Water that’s too hard or too soft could damage pipes and lead to health and aesthetic concerns. If you are on a low sodium diet, ask your healthcare provider if it is okay for you to drink softened water.
